
Vodafone
Vodafone in York offers a comprehensive range of mobile phones, broadband services, and expert advice for all your communication needs.
Located on Parliament Street in the historic city of York, Vodafone provides visitors and residents alike with a convenient hub for all their mobile communication and connectivity needs. As a leading telecommunications provider, this store offers a wide selection of the latest mobile phones, SIM-only plans, and home broadband solutions. It’s a go-to spot for those looking to upgrade, start a new contract, or explore innovative tech products.
The team at Vodafone York is on hand to guide customers through their range of services, helping them find the best deals and explaining contract details clearly. Whether you're troubleshooting a device issue or seeking advice on broadband packages, staff are dedicated to offering support and ensuring a smooth experience, as highlighted by customers praising thorough explanations and helpful problem-solving.
Visiting Information
Vodafone York is open Monday to Saturday from 9:00 AM to 5:30 PM, and on Sundays from 10:30 AM to 4:30 PM. The store features a wheelchair-accessible entrance, ensuring ease of access for all visitors. For payment, customers can conveniently use credit cards, debit cards, or NFC mobile payments.
